Description

Beginning with an anatomic overview of the female trunk, the sequence lays out the thoracic and abdominopelvic viscera in situ, clarifying how the lungs flank the mediastinum while the heart sits centrally, slightly left of midline, deep to the sternum and costal cartilages. Inferior to the diaphragm, the liver occupies the right upper quadrant, the stomach lies more left and posterior, and the small intestine fills the central abdomen with the colon framing it peripherally from cecum to sigmoid. As the animation progresses caudally, pelvic relationships come into focus, with the uterus positioned midline between the urinary bladder anteriorly and rectum posteriorly, and the ovaries situated laterally near the pelvic sidewall. Depth cues and timed reveals help separate overlapping organ margins. Spatial orientation becomes obvious. Clinical work often hinges on knowing what lies anterior, posterior, or medial before you place a probe, interpret a CT slice, or plan a surgical corridor. Rotating and stepping through the visceral arrangement makes it easier to understand why left lower lobe pneumonia can refer pain to the upper abdomen, why hepatomegaly displaces the gastric bubble and transverse colon, and how gravid uterine enlargement elevates bowel loops and can alter the clinical presentation of appendicitis. Motion adds what a single diagram cannot: you track how organ surfaces relate across levels and how cavities transition from thorax to abdomen to pelvis. Educators can drop this animation into gross anatomy lab prep, organ-systems blocks (digestive, respiratory, cardiovascular, and reproductive), or radiology teaching sessions that map surface anatomy to axial, coronal, and sagittal imaging. Medical publishers and patient-education teams will also find it suited to preoperative counseling for laparoscopy, hysterectomy, or abdominal imaging workflows where orientation errors are common.
